Default Tires for the strip...

Okay guys and gals... I need guidance from you drag racers...

I want a set of rears just for drag racing that'll fit under my non-tubbed Z06.

What size and type/brand do you recommend? I won't necessarily have to use these on the street at all since I can trailer my car to the track, so being street legal isn't an issue.

Thanks everyone!

Default Re: Tires for the strip... (Bigtoe)

No expert here; but recently took the plunge myself; so here goes.

The choices are drag radials (BFG or Nitto are the favs) or biased ply slicks (MT rules here).

DR come in 17" while the slicks come in 16".

I chose BFG 315x35x17 mounted on 12" wide wheels from CCWheel. My 8 runs on them so far have averaged 1.88 60'; believe they'll do better with some practice. You run stock tires on the front.

The main alternative is the MT ET-Drags or ET-Streets. Both come in 16" and with them, you'll need to run biased-ply fronts to keep the car from getting squirrelly beyond 100 mph. Beside that you need to do some grinding to get the wheels to fit. Wasn't comfortable doing that for warranty reasons. Nonetheless, the MTs will bring better 60' than the DR, all other things being equal.

Lotsa threads and opinions on this topic in the archives.
